Andhra accident: 8 pilgrims from Karnataka killed as pick-up truck collides with tanker on Kurnool highway
The accident occurred on National Highway 167 near the Karnataka border, when the vehicle, carrying around 20–21 passengers en route to Mantralayam, crashed into an oncoming truck. The impact was severe, killing eight people on the spot, including women and a child, while the injured were rushed to nearby hospitals. Police have launched an investigation into the cause of the accident.

Noida violence fallout: UP govt threatens to blacklist labour contractors if workers incite unrest
Authorities said contractors and outsourcing agencies will be held accountable for any disruptive or violent behaviour, with the possibility of blacklisting and licence cancellation. The move comes after large-scale protests turned violent with incidents of arson, stone-pelting and vandalism, prompting arrests and heightened security across the region. Officials have stressed the need to maintain industrial discipline and prevent further disturbances.
